Bishops Cuts And Color Donating 10 Percent Of Earth Day Profits To TreesUpstate

Bishops Cuts and Color, a Simpsonville unisex hair care shop offering quality service at affordable prices, is honoring the mission of Earth Day on April 22nd to “diversify, educate, and activate the environmental movement” by donating 10 percent of Monday’s profits to TreesUpstate. Recently renamed from TreesGreenville, this group is committed to keeping the Upstate green by planting trees and educating the community about protecting the environment.

“Giving back to the community that supports us is the cornerstone of the Bishops mission,” said Kevin Trexler, owner of Bishops Simpsonville. “Being environmentally conscious is something we value and commit to every day through our use of vegan color products by Pulp Riot. We look forward to taking that to the local level by supporting TreesUpstate in honor of Earth Day.”

Community involvement is a key component of the Bishops brand, which has supported many national nonprofits including the Leukemia & Lymphoma Society, and the American Diabetes Association. In addition, Bishops Simpsonville looks forward to partnering with other local non-profits, including the Salvation Army of Greenville, and Boys & Girls Club of Greenville County.
